The deadline to file your taxes is fast approaching. 

Active duty members, their dependents and retirees are all eligible to have their returns prepared free of charge at the Andersen Tax Center. 

The tax center has qualified volunteers to assist members in filing their taxes. Take advantage of this free service before it's too late. You may qualify for credits or deductions you don't know about. 

The tax center is open Monday through Friday from noon to 4 p.m. 

If you are filing a 1040EZ, you may walk in during office hours. Those filing a 1040 or 1040A must make an appointment by calling 366-4TAX (4829). 

Taxpayers are encouraged to bring Social Security cards for themselves and dependents, W-2s, 1099s, bank account and routing information, and any other applicable tax information. 

The Andersen Tax Center will close on April 17.
